Food and Beverage Service Manager

Kings Creek Country Club

Job Description

Job Description

Position SummaryThe Food & Beverage Service Manager is responsible for the day-to-day leadership of all front-of-house operations, ensuring exceptional member experience and consistent execution of the Club's hospitality standards. This position leads daily dining operations, supervises service staff, supports special events, maintains presentation standards throughout the clubhouse, and works closely and report to the Food & Beverage Director, Executive Chef, and Events and Catering Manager to deliver outstanding service while continuously improving operational efficiency.Mission StatementKings Creek Country Club is dedicated to providing superior country club amenities of exceptional value, including golf, racquet sports, fitness, and swimming facilities and programs, a first-class dining experience and consistent service excellence, in a warm, relaxed atmosphere for the enjoyment of our members and their guests.Primary ResponsibilitiesDaily Operations & Service LeadershipServe as the primary floor manager during meal periods, overseeing all front-of-house operations. Ensure every member and guest receives professional, personalized service consistent with Club standards. Anticipate service needs and proactively resolve member concerns before they become issues. Monitor dining room flow, staffing levels, and table management to maximize efficiency. Maintain a visible leadership presence during peak service periods. Clubhouse & Dining Room StandardsEnsure the clubhouse, dining rooms, patios, and event spaces are fully prepared prior to service. Conduct daily opening inspections to verify cleanliness, organization, lighting, music, décor, and overall presentation. Maintain exceptional standards for table settings, linens, centerpieces, menus, and seasonal displays. Continuously enhance the dining room ambiance to elevate the overall member experience. Team LeadershipSupervise hosts, servers, bartenders, food runners, and support staff during daily operations. Coach employees in real time to improve service execution and member engagement. Reinforce appearance, uniform, grooming, and professional conduct standards. Assist with interviewing, onboarding, scheduling, training, and performance development of front-of-house staff. Foster a positive, accountable, and team-oriented work environment. Training & Staff DevelopmentPartner with the Food & Beverage Director and Events and Catering Manager to develop and implement training programs. Conduct regular service training focused on hospitality, wine service, food knowledge, POS procedures, and service standards. Mentor staff to continuously improve professionalism and service consistency. Assist with orientation and ongoing education for new employees. Operational AdministrationProgram daily and weekly specials in the Jonas POS system. Verify menu accuracy, pricing, and mobile ordering functionality. Monitor dining room supplies and coordinate replenishment with support staff. Ensure server stations remain stocked, organized, and service-ready throughout each shift. Wine & Beverage ProgramAssist in managing the Club's wine program. Coordinate wine tastings, staff education, and member wine events. Support wine list updates, inventory organization, and menu integration. Promote wine sales through staff education and member engagement. Member ExperienceBuild strong relationships with members through frequent interaction and attentive service. Address member feedback promptly and professionally. Follow-up on service recovery opportunities to ensure complete member satisfaction. Promote a hospitality culture that consistently exceeds expectations. Standards & ComplianceEnsure compliance with health department regulations, alcohol service laws, and Club policies. Monitor cleanliness, sanitation, and safety throughout all front-of-house areas. Maintain proper opening and closing procedures. Support inventory control and minimize waste while protecting Club assets. QualificationsMinimum 3-5 years of progressive Food & Beverage management experience, preferably in a private club, luxury hotel, or upscale restaurant. Strong leadership and team development skills. Excellent communication and member service abilities. Experience managing high-end dining and banquet operations. Knowledge of wine service and fine dining etiquette preferred. Experience with Jonas POS or similar hospitality systems preferred. Ability to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as required. Professional appearance with exceptional attention to detail.Must be able to occasionally lift and carry items weighing up to 50 pounds.
